Ana içeriğe atla

Kayıtlar

2011 tarihine ait yayınlar gösteriliyor

Su Toplayan Ayak Acısı (2011-09-11 Pazar)

Yüreği yaralı dolaşmaz mı? Dolaşır elbet... Tahammül edilemez acının dinmesi için Kalabalığa karışır Dolaşır, yürür Yetmez... Devam eder Ayak parmaklarındaki sızıyı hissetmeye başlar bir yandan Aldırmaz... Bazen duymaz yürek acısının tazeliğiyle... Başka türlü görür herşeyi... Tek istediği o dayanılmaz acıyı atmaktır içinden Peki atsa memnun olacak mıdır? HAYIR Çünkü beslenir oradan aynı zamanda... Ayak parmakları memnun değildir bu durumdan Sinyaller gönderir ve haykırır HAYDİ ARTIK DİNLENELİM Duymaz bu sesi yüreği Daha yürüyecek çok yol vardır Tarifsiz acının dinmesi, bir nebze olsun rahatlaması, Üzerine dökülecek bir damla su için... Su toplayan ayak acısının önemi hiç bu kadar az olamazdı... Volkan Özyılmaz

Aşkı Anlatan Engüzel Hikayelerden Pervane İle Mum (2001-08-27 Cumartesi)

Pervane, mum alevinin çevresinde mıknatısi bir güç ile döner durur. Tıpkı sevgilinin mahallesinden ayrılamayan aşık gibi. O kadar ki, gittikçe daha fazla cesaretlenerek daha yakın hareket etmeye, dönerken çizdiği çemberin yarıçapını daraltmaya başlar. Böylece cesareti şevkini artırır, şevki arttıkça da cesaret bulur. Tıpkı sevgilisine yaklaştıkça daha fazla yaklaşmak için bahaneler arayan aşık gibi. Öyle ki, pervane birkaç zaman sonra muma iyice yaklaşmış olur. Bu sefer de onun gerçeğini anlamak ister ve kendısiyle onu aynileştirmek için dönüş çemberini iyice daraltır. Bu da, tıpkı sevgilisine yaklaşınca ona dokunmak, onunla konuşmak, onun sıcaklığını duymak isteyen aşığın haline benzer. Ve nihayet pervane mumun ateşine kanadını uzatır/kaptırır ve yanmanın ne demek olduğunu hakka'l-yakin öğrenir. Önce duyarak/okuyarak, sonra da görerek edindiği yanış bilgisi bu sefer gerçeklik kazanır ve aşk ateşi pervanenin narin vücudunu küle döndürür. Tıpkı aşığın aşk ateşiyle yanıp yakılması v...

MacOSX Program Kaldırmak

MacOSX için karşımıza iki çeşit kurulum (install) dosyası çıkıyor. Biri dmg uzantılı dosyalar (aslında dmg uzantılı dosyalar kurulum dosyaları değildir, disk imajı saklarlar) diğeri ise pkg uzantılı dosyalar. dmg uzantılı dosyalar için bir beis yok, onları açtıktan sonra içinden çıkan dosyayı alıp Application klasörüne sürüklüyoruz kurulum gerçekleşiyor, kaldırmak istediğimizde ise Application klasöründen siliyoruz ve iş bitiyor. Gerçekten basit ve güzel. Fakat her program bununla yetinemiyor ve bunun bir çok nedeni olabilir. Neticede pkg uzantılı kurulum dosyaları sisteminizin değişik yerlerine değişik dosyalar kopyalıyorlar. Windows'taki gibi registery yok ve ben bundan çok memnunum. Registery için bir çok performans problemi yatatıldığını biliyoruz, her açılışta ve kapanışta yapılan taramalar v.b.. Aynı zamanda uninstall için gereken sistem de MacOSX'te yok. Dolayısı ile bir programı kaldırmak istediğimizde pkg kurulum dosyasını nereye ne yazdığını bilmemiz gerekir. Bu bil...

Cpp İçinde Obj-C Kullanmak (2011-07-10 Pazar)

Objective-C bilmiyorum ve eğer mümkün olursa bilmek te istemiyorum :) Fakat yolum cocoa'ya düştü sandım ve bu konuyu araştırdım. Daha sonra Carbon kullandım. Cplusplus içinde Objectıve-C fonksıyonu çağırmak çok basit. Öncelikle şunu belirteyim, Objective-C içinde C++ kullanabiliyorsunuz. Hemen konuya geçelim. Xcode4 kullanıyorum ve her dosyayı C++ source veya Objective-C source olarak seçebiliyorsunuz. Gerçi kendisi dosya uzantısına göre yaratılırken belirliyor ama isterseniz değiştirebilirsiniz. Bir consol tabanlı C++ projemiz olsun. Bu projenin içine ilk olarak a.m diye bir dosya ekleyelim. Sonra içine şu satırları yazalım: // a.m #import ‹Foundation/Foundation.h› void a_func() { NSString *str = @"Test"; NSLog(str); } Burada gördüğünüz gibi fonksiyon tanımlamasını C/C++ syntax'ında yaptık. Fakat fonksiyonun içeriği Objective-C formatında. İsterseniz başka bir Objective-C class'ı yazıp buradan o class'ı çağırabilirsiniz. Şimdi gelelim ...

İçinde Kaybolmak (2011-07-09 Cumartesi)

Aslında içinde kaybolmak önemlidir herşeyin. Eğer girip orada kalabiliyorsan muhteşemdir. Giremiyorsan ve yapmak zorundaysan çekilmezdir. Başka bir boyuttur içinde kaybolmak. Hareket etmeden dolaşmaktır. Peki, o zaman girmek neden problem olur? Zor mudur? Aslında hayır. Zor falan değildir. Uygun ortamı hazırlamak gerekir sadece. Eğer giremiyorsanız ortamda problem vardır büyük ihtimalle. İçinde kaybolmadan anlayamayız da zaten. Belki anladık sanırız, kendimizi kandırırız. Mesele hep özdedir. Öz nerededir? Sığ sularda olma ihtimali var mı? Odaklanmak derinleri net görmemizi sağlar. Etraftaki gereksiz detayları atar meselenin özüne yolculuk başlar. İşte o muhteşem anlar böyle gelir. Eminim, biraz araştırsam o anda vücudun salgıladığı özel bir hormon da vardır. İçinde kaybolmak önemlidir. Hareket etmeden dolaşmayı sağlar. Volkan Özyılmaz

SVN'den Git'e Taşınma (2011-06-03 Cuma)

Bir süre önce Git isminde yeni bir versiyon kontrol sisteminin ciddi popüler olduğunu gördüm ve incelemeye başladım. Daha önce SVN (Sub Version) kullanıyordum ve Git kullanmaya karar verdim. Fakat eski repository (code depoları) SVN'den Git'e aktarmam gerekiyordu. İnternette yaptığım küçük bir araştırmadan sonra aşağıdaki şablonu buldum. Benim depolarımda büyük ölçüde çalıştı. Fakat Windows altında garip bir hata verdi. Mac OS X ile bir problem çıkarmadı. git svn clone "repository path" --no-metadata -A "authors_file.txt" -t tags -b branches -T trunk "destination-dir" "repository path" SVN deponuzun adresini temsil ediyor. SVN'yi direkt diskten kullandığım için file:///c:/svn/repository_name şeklinde kullandım. "destination_dir" işlemi hangi klasöre yapacağınızı belirtir. Örneğin, c:/project/repository_name "authors_file.txt" SVN içindeki authors bilgilerini belirtir. Her bir satırda bir author bilgisi bulu...

Mac OS X Neden Harika Bir İşletim Sistemidir?

- Çünkü Mac OS X en bilgisiz kullanıcıya da en bilgili kullanıcıya da hitap ediyor. - Çünkü Mac OS X ismine baktığınızda gördüğünüz 'X' Unix'i ifade ediyor. - Çünkü Mac OS X Unix'in terminaline sahip. - Çünkü bir programcı Unix'in terminaline bayılır. - Çünkü bir çok açık kaynaklı proje Unix desteği sayesinde rahatça kullanılabilinir. - Çünkü Mac OS X aynı zamanda bir Linux. Tüm bunları bir araya getirdiğimizde Mac OS X çok geniş bir yelpazeye hitap ediyor. Herkesi memnun ediyor. Volkan Özyılmaz

Git ile Gecmis Author Bilgilerini Degistirmek (2011-05-21 Pazar)

Subversion - SVN kullanıyordum ve git kullanmaya başladım. Bu geçiş sürecinde eski depomu (repository) git formatına çevirdim. Çevirirken farkettim ki eski depomun (repository) yazarı (Author) farklı. Tabi eski bilgileri değiştirmek istedim ve aşağıdaki script'i buldum. git filter-branch --commit-filter ' if [ "$GIT_COMMITTER_NAME" = "name" ]; then GIT_COMMITTER_NAME="new name"; GIT_AUTHOR_NAME="new name"; GIT_COMMITTER_EMAIL="new e-mail"; GIT_AUTHOR_EMAIL="new e-mail"; git commit-tree "$@"; else git commit-tree "$@"; fi' HEAD

Bilinçdışıma Parizyenden Müjde (2011-04-14 Perşembe)

İki-üç hafta önce evde arkadaşlarla sohpet halindeydik. Bir yandan da müzik çalıyor. Çalan müziğin kime ait olduğunu merak ettim. Sordum. "Kim çalıyor?". Emile Parisien dediler. Soyadı okunuş olarak bir anda etkiledi, nedense çok beğendim, parizyen. 2-3 dakika sonra kararımı vermiştim. Parizyen isminden harika çorap markası olur diye düşündüm ve düşüncelerimi kelimelere dökerek arkadaşlara da söyledim. Ben söyler söylemez abim "Müjde Parizyen'di galiba" dedi. Meriç onu hemen düzeltti. "Yok o şarkının içindeki kelime, parizyen markanın ismi ." Ben afalladım aslında, galiba parizyen bir çorap markasının ismiydi. Bu kadar tesadüf olamaz diye düşünürken Meriç şarkıyı da patlattı ve söylemeye başladı. "Müjde, müjde size, parizyenden müjde size, zarif, sağlam, esnek çorap...". Evet gerçekler su yüzüne çıkmıştı. Reklamı hatırlamıştım. Müziğini de. Biliç dışımız böyle işte. Geçmişteki bilgilerimizi bize farkında olmadan sürekli çalışıp sunuyor. ...

Aşkın Dört Hali (2011-04-12)

Bilindiği gibi aşk kelimesinin bir anlamı da, "sevgide ölçüyü aşmak, sınırın ötesine geçmek" demektir. Her aşk, sevginin dozu çoğaltılmış drajeleridir. Bu yüzden her sevgi aşk olamaz; ama aşk mutlaka damıtılmış sevgidir. Arifler katında aşka düşen kişinin dört hali vardır: Kabz(tutukluk, sıkıştırılmışlık hissi ve hesaba çekilme), bast (açıklık; zihnin açık, gönlün şen olması), sekr (sarhoşluk, kayıtlardan ve alakalardan kurtulup yalnızca sevgili ile oluş, onda kendini yitiriş hali) ve sahv (ayıklık, kendinden geçen aşığın yeniden kendine gelmesi). Aşkın en aşkın ve taşkın hali sekrdir. Sekr halinde aşık ne yaptığını da ne söylediğini de bilmez. Burada bilinçsizlık değil, irade dışılık söz konusudur. Belki önce kabil (türlü), ardından vasıl (ulaşan) ve nihayet fani (ölümlü) olmuş bir aşığın özel ve özenilesi hali söz konusudur. İşte bu yüzden sekr halindeki aşığa yaptıklarından ve söylediklerinden dolayı sorgu sual caiz olmaz. Sarhoşa yalpalama denilebilir mi? Yukarıdak...

Hani İnsanın Gözleri Buğlanırya (2011-02-25 Cuma)

Yüreği farklı atar ama bilemez nedenini Aslında bilir, biri gelip yerleşmiştir yüreğine İstese de çıkaramaz onu oradan İstemese de girmesine engel olamadığı gibi Anlayamaz neden! Neden ve nasıl oldu bu olan! Sanki başının üzerinde bir hare var O hare bağlanmıştır yüreğine yerleşeninkiyle O bağ kopmaz arada 2000 km olsa bile İşte o anların bazıları dalga dalga gelir üzerine O dalgalar çok zorlar ama çok Dalga geri çekilirken sanır ki bitti Aslında boğuşulması gereken daha çok dalga vardır önünde Bazen kısılıp kalır küçücük sesi Ağzından bir kelime değil bir harf bile çıkamaz Gözleri dolar Bi kadeh rakıyla sarhoş olur İnsanların içinde utanır, gider tuvalette ağlar Bazen de insanın gözleri buğlanır Perde vardır gözlerinde, göremez dünyayı başkaları gibi Gözlerdeki o buğ, Allah'ın bir lütfudur aynı zamanda Volkan Özyılmaz

Apache 2.2.17 ile Php 5.2.17 Kurulum Problemi (2011-01-25)

Apache'yi kurdunuz, ardından php'yi de Apache'nin conf klasörünü göstererek (httpd.conf dosyasını modifiye etmesi için) extension'ları ile beraber kurdunuz. Apache'nin start tuşuna basınca sunucu(server)'ın çalışmasını bekliyorsunuz. Çok beklersiniz!! İlk olarak httpd.conf dosyasına (genelde sonuna ekliyor) php'nin eklemelerine bakıyorsunuz. Path bilgileri girilmemiş. #BEGIN PHP INSTALLER EDITS - REMOVE ONLY ON UNINSTALL PHPIniDir "" LoadModule php5_module "php5apache2_2.dll" #END PHP INSTALLER EDITS - REMOVE ONLY ON UNINSTALL Bu satırları kurulum yaptığınız path (yol) bilgileri ile güncelliyorsunuz. #BEGIN PHP INSTALLER EDITS - REMOVE ONLY ON UNINSTALL PHPIniDir "c:/webapps/php" LoadModule php5_module "c:/webapps/php/php5apache2_2.dll" #END PHP INSTALLER EDITS - REMOVE ONLY ON UNINSTALL Bu değişikliği yaptıktan sonra Apache'nin çalışacağını düşünüyorsunuz normal olarak. Ama heyhat! çalışmıyor. Apac...